
在Excel中查询数值区间的方法主要包括:使用条件格式、使用IF函数、使用VLOOKUP函数、使用FILTER函数和使用数据筛选功能。这些方法可以根据不同的需求和复杂性来选择使用。以下将详细描述其中一个方法:使用IF函数。
使用IF函数来查询数值区间是一个灵活且常用的方法。通过IF函数,可以根据特定条件设置不同的返回结果。例如,假设你有一个包含学生分数的列表,并希望根据分数范围给出相应的等级。你可以使用IF函数在不同的分数区间返回不同的等级。
=IF(A2>=90, "A", IF(A2>=80, "B", IF(A2>=70, "C", IF(A2>=60, "D", "F"))))
这段公式将分数分为五个区间,并根据每个区间返回相应的等级。接下来,我们将详细探讨各种方法在不同情境下的应用。
一、条件格式
条件格式是Excel中一种非常强大的工具,它允许你根据单元格中的数值自动改变单元格的格式。通过条件格式,可以轻松地突出显示特定数值区间内的数值,以下是具体步骤:
设置条件格式
- 选择数据范围:首先,选择你希望应用条件格式的数据范围。
- 打开条件格式菜单:点击“开始”选项卡中的“条件格式”,然后选择“新建规则”。
- 设定条件:在新建规则窗口中选择“使用公式确定要设置格式的单元格”,然后输入你的条件公式。例如,要突出显示大于50且小于100的数值,可以输入公式
=AND(A1>50, A1<100)。 - 设置格式:点击“格式”按钮,设置你希望应用的格式,例如改变字体颜色或背景颜色。
- 应用:点击“确定”完成设置。
实例应用
假设你有一列包含销售额的数据,并希望突出显示销售额在5000到10000之间的单元格。你可以按上述步骤设置条件格式,使用公式=AND(A1>=5000, A1<=10000),然后设置一个醒目的背景颜色。
二、IF函数
IF函数是Excel中最常用的函数之一,它可以根据指定条件返回不同的值。在查询数值区间时,IF函数特别有用。
基本用法
IF函数的基本语法如下:
IF(条件, 值1, 值2)
其中,条件是你要评估的逻辑表达式,如果条件为真,函数返回值1,否则返回值2。为了处理多个条件,可以将IF函数嵌套使用。
实例应用
假设你有一个包含学生分数的列表,并希望根据分数范围给出相应的等级。可以使用以下公式:
=IF(A2>=90, "A", IF(A2>=80, "B", IF(A2>=70, "C", IF(A2>=60, "D", "F"))))
这段公式将分数分为五个区间,并根据每个区间返回相应的等级。
三、VLOOKUP函数
VLOOKUP函数在Excel中被广泛用于查找和引用数据。它可以根据一个值在一个表格或范围内查找对应的值。虽然VLOOKUP主要用于查找精确匹配,但也可以用于查找数值区间。
基本用法
VLOOKUP函数的基本语法如下:
VLOOKUP(查找值, 表格区域, 列索引号, [匹配类型])
其中,查找值是你希望查找的值,表格区域是包含要查找数据的范围,列索引号是返回值所在的列,匹配类型为TRUE时表示查找近似匹配,为FALSE时表示查找精确匹配。
实例应用
假设你有一个包含销售额的列表,并希望根据销售额的范围返回相应的折扣率。首先,需要创建一个包含销售额区间和对应折扣率的表格。例如:
| 销售额 | 折扣率 |
|---|---|
| 0 | 0% |
| 5000 | 5% |
| 10000 | 10% |
| 15000 | 15% |
然后,可以使用VLOOKUP函数查找对应的折扣率:
=VLOOKUP(A2, $E$2:$F$5, 2, TRUE)
在这个公式中,A2是你要查找的销售额,$E$2:$F$5是包含销售额区间和折扣率的表格区域,2表示折扣率在表格的第二列,TRUE表示查找近似匹配。
四、FILTER函数
FILTER函数是Excel 365和Excel 2019中的新功能,它允许你根据指定条件过滤数据。使用FILTER函数,你可以轻松地查询和提取符合特定数值区间的数据。
基本用法
FILTER函数的基本语法如下:
FILTER(数组, 包含条件, [如果空])
其中,数组是你要过滤的数据范围,包含条件是你希望应用的过滤条件,[如果空]是一个可选参数,用于指定如果没有符合条件的数据时返回的值。
实例应用
假设你有一个包含销售额的数据列表,并希望提取销售额在5000到10000之间的数据。可以使用以下公式:
=FILTER(A2:A20, (A2:A20>=5000)*(A2:A20<=10000), "没有符合条件的数据")
在这个公式中,A2:A20是你要过滤的数据范围,(A2:A20>=5000)*(A2:A20<=10000)是包含条件,表示提取销售额在5000到10000之间的数据。如果没有符合条件的数据,返回“没有符合条件的数据”。
五、数据筛选功能
Excel的筛选功能允许你根据特定条件过滤和查看数据。通过数据筛选功能,可以轻松地查询和显示符合特定数值区间的数据。
设置数据筛选
- 选择数据范围:首先,选择包含你希望筛选的数据范围。
- 启用筛选功能:点击“数据”选项卡中的“筛选”按钮。
- 设置筛选条件:点击列标题旁边的下拉箭头,选择“数字筛选”,然后选择“介于”。在弹出的对话框中输入你希望筛选的数值区间,例如5000和10000。
- 应用筛选:点击“确定”应用筛选条件。
实例应用
假设你有一个包含销售额的数据列表,并希望显示销售额在5000到10000之间的数据。可以按上述步骤设置数据筛选功能,选择“介于”并输入5000和10000。这样,Excel将只显示符合条件的数据行。
结论
在Excel中查询数值区间的方法有很多,包括条件格式、IF函数、VLOOKUP函数、FILTER函数和数据筛选功能。每种方法都有其独特的优势和适用场景。条件格式适用于视觉化突出显示特定区间的数据,IF函数适用于根据不同区间返回不同的值,VLOOKUP函数适用于查找和引用数据,FILTER函数适用于根据条件提取数据,而数据筛选功能则适用于交互式数据过滤。根据具体需求选择合适的方法,可以大大提高工作效率和数据分析的准确性。
相关问答FAQs:
1. 我在Excel中如何使用函数查询数值区间?
在Excel中,你可以使用IF函数来查询数值区间。使用IF函数的嵌套,可以根据条件来返回不同的结果。你可以设置多个IF函数嵌套来实现查询数值区间的功能。
2. 如何在Excel中创建一个数值区间表格?
要创建一个数值区间表格,你可以使用Excel的条件格式功能。首先,选择你想要设置数值区间的单元格范围。然后,通过选择“条件格式”选项卡中的“颜色刻度”或“数据条”选项,来设置你的数值区间。这样,Excel会根据你设置的条件自动为每个单元格应用不同的颜色或数据条,以显示数值所在的区间。
3. 如何在Excel中对数值区间进行排序?
如果你想在Excel中对数值区间进行排序,可以使用Excel的排序功能。选择你想要排序的列或区域,然后点击“数据”选项卡上的“排序”按钮。在排序对话框中,选择你想要排序的列,并选择“值”作为排序依据。然后,选择升序或降序排序方式,并点击“确定”按钮即可对数值区间进行排序。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4319970